Cartogiraffe.com

Decatur Street

The Decatur Street is a street with two lanes in Denver. In the area there are, inter alia, two bus stops.

Pin to show location on the map Decatur Street

type of road
Secondary road
Lanes
2
Trade
Ron's Welding & Fabrication
Bus stop
Decatur Street & West 8th Avenue, Decatur Street & West 10th Avenue